UTime Limited, a global technology company, has signed a Cooperation Agreement with Shenzhen Yunwei Digital for the supply of 500,000 smart servers, worth approximately $50 million. These servers are powered by the RK3566 chipset and have 4GB of RAM and 128GB of storage. This marks UTime’s expansion into the enterprise and cloud infrastructure sector, showcasing its technological capabilities. The agreement aims to establish a long-term partnership for next-generation computing solutions. The contract is expected to be finalized by mid-February 2026, with deliveries starting soon after and continuing through 2027.
